A Little Piece of Earth

We live in an area of mostly condos, townhouses, and apartments. Our stake realizes that because of our living situations, we don't have any land to enjoy as our own for a garden. They have resolved this by providing anyone in the stake that is interested with a 10' x 15' garden plot located next to the church. When Matthew and I heard about this opportunity, we knew we would be the first to sign up. Neither of us had planted a garden of our own but were very excited about trying it together.With all the crazy weather this year, it took us a while to get our plants into the ground and decided to start things off right with starter plants. We planted 2 Roma Tomatoes, 1 Whopper Tomato, 1 Grape Tomato, Cucumbers, Carrots, 2 Bell Peppers, 4 Red Peppers, Peas, Watermelon, and Zucchini. We are loving taking care of our plants, watching them grow, and seeing the results.
